CINCINNATI - The University of Cincinnati women's tennis team will continue fall play with two matches, the Milwaukee Tennis Classic and Bradley Invitational. The Milwaukee Tennis Classic will begin on September 20, running through September 23. The Bradley Invitational will begin on September 21, running through September 23.
// MILWAUKEE TENNIS CLASSIC
Caroline Morton and Ioana Guna will represent the Bearcats at the Milwaukee Tennis Classic in Milwaukee, Wisconsin. This will be their first action of the fall season. The women's opening rounds will be held at Western Racquet Club and are open to the public. The finals will be held at Al McGuire Center on the campus of Marquette University and will require tickets.

// BRADLEY INVITATIONAL
The rest of the Bearcats will take to the court in Peoria, Illinois at the Bradley Invitational. The team will face competitors from St. Louis, Bradley, Northern Illinois, Western Illinois and Depaul.
